6. Destination where you want to install the VMware Server software, you can leave it as default and click Next to continue.



7. It will be better to disabled the Windows CD-ROM auto run feature, because your guest OS CD device may mounted directly to your CD-ROM, ensure the Yes disable autorun is Ticked and click Next to continue.



8. Above is the last step of installation wizard configuration click Install to begin the installation.



9. Do not interrupt the installation until it completed, for my case this completed in less than 10 minutes.



10. In this stage you need to key in the Serial Number that VMware send to your registered email, you need to Activate the account.
Fill the User Name, and Copy and Paste the Serial Number and Click Enter to Continue.



11. And now VMware is successful installed, you need to reboot your system so that the step 7 that disabling the CD-ROM autorun is taking effect
